TAMC Policies
To ensure consistency, TAMC has adopted several policies governing the way data will be collected, stored, and distributed, for both Federal-Aid Eligible and Non-Federal-Aid roads. Additional policies can be found here, along with the current bylaws that govern the organization and operation of TAMC.
